Add 50/80 and 27/14
1st number: 50/80, 2nd number: 1 13/14
50/80 + 27/14 is 143/56.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 80 and 14 is 560
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 560 - For the 1st fraction, since 80 × 7 = 560,
50/80 = 50 × 7/80 × 7 = 350/560 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 40 = 560,
27/14 = 27 × 40/14 × 40 = 1080/560 - Add the two like fractions:
350/560 + 1080/560 = 350 + 1080/560 = 1430/560 - 1430/560 simplified gives 143/56
- So, 50/80 + 27/14 = 143/56
